Green tea has been consumed for centuries in Asian cultures, but only recently has the Western world caught on to its remarkable health benefits. From weight loss to disease prevention, this simple beverage packs a powerful punch.

The Science Behind Green Tea

Green tea is rich in catechins, particularly epigallocatechin gallate (EGCG), which is a powerful antioxidant. These compounds work in several ways to promote weight loss and improve health.

How Green Tea Aids Weight Loss

1. Boosts Metabolism

Studies show that green tea extract can increase metabolic rate by 4-5%. The combination of caffeine and catechins works synergistically to enhance fat burning, especially during exercise.

2. Increases Fat Oxidation

Green tea specifically increases the oxidation of fat. One study found that men who took green tea extract before exercise burned 17% more fat than those who took a placebo.

3. Reduces Appetite

The compounds in green tea may help regulate hunger hormones, making you feel fuller for longer and reducing overall calorie intake.

4. Mobilizes Fat from Fat Cells

The active compounds in green tea can help release fat from fat cells, particularly in the abdominal area, making it available to be used as energy.

Best Times to Drink Green Tea

Morning (30 minutes before breakfast)

Drinking green tea on an empty stomach can boost metabolism for the day ahead. If you have a sensitive stomach, have it with a small snack.

Before Exercise (30-60 minutes prior)

Consuming green tea before a workout can increase fat burning during exercise and improve endurance.

Between Meals

Drinking green tea between meals can help curb cravings and prevent overeating at your next meal.

How to Prepare Green Tea for Maximum Benefits

Water Temperature: Never use boiling water - ideal temperature is 160-170°F (70-80°C). Let boiling water cool for 2-3 minutes.
Steeping Time: Steep for 2-3 minutes. Longer steeping can make the tea bitter.
Add Lemon: Adding lemon helps preserve catechins and makes them more absorbable.
Avoid Milk: Milk may reduce antioxidant activity of green tea.

How Much to Drink

Most studies showing benefits use 3-5 cups per day. Start with 1-2 cups if you're sensitive to caffeine.

Other Health Benefits

  • Heart health: Reduces LDL cholesterol and triglycerides
  • Brain function: Improves focus and may protect against neurodegenerative diseases
  • Skin health: Antioxidants fight aging and acne
  • Blood sugar: Helps regulate glucose levels
